摘要
周边脱砂压裂技术是压裂技术从常规压裂到脱砂压裂,再到端部脱砂压裂技术之后发展起来的一种新的技术,只有该技术才可能在压裂中形成相对较短、较宽裂缝。目前对于脱砂压裂裂缝扩展模型的研究大都忽略了裂缝纵向流动。为此,在前人的研究基础上,针对周边脱砂压裂的特点将带缝高压降影响的拟三维模型引入到脱砂后裂缝扩展模型,在脱砂后模型中考虑缝宽方向压降对裂缝扩展的影响,推导了适合周边脱砂压裂的脱砂后新模型;并在此基础上开发了适合周边脱砂压裂扩展的模拟软件,模拟结果与现有商业软件(三维)模拟结果相吻合,证明建立的脱砂后模型考虑因素全面,对脱砂后缝宽预测更符合实际。
The peripheral sand out fracturing is a new technology evolving after the conventional fracturing,sand-out fracturing and end sand-out fracturing.The technique could form shorter and wider fractures.Most related research on fracture extension model in sand-out fracturing overlooked the vertical flow of cracks.Therefore,based on present studies and aiming at the properties of peripheral sand-out fracturing,the pseudo-three dimensional model considering the fractured high pressure difference was introduced into the sand-out fracture extension model.In the model,the effect of pressure drop in the direction of crack width on the fracture extension was taken into consideration,and a new sand-out model appropriate for peripheral sand-out fracturing was derived.Meanwhile,useful simulation software appropriate for peripheral sand-out fracture extension was developed.Simulation results agreed well with the three dimensional results of available commercial software.It was validated the integrity in factor consideration for the established sand-out model.The model could provide more practical simulation on fracture width after sanding-out.
